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
840186 95087 46116468813
83 3117329 152
83 3117329 152
9694821 2709 84141381290
All about undefined
Interested in learning more?
83 3117329 152
9694821 2709 84141381290
See more
74483 17589733 0463266
82684 6176108220 43
See more
61101314 776789064
7578627 6001 9358 55286
See more